The cheapest way to get from Levallois-Perret to Bonne Nouvelle is to line 3 subway and line 9 subway which costs €3 and takes 19 min.
The fastest way to get from Levallois-Perret to Bonne Nouvelle is to taxi which takes 12 min and costs €13 - €16.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Porte de Clichy and arriving at Réaumur - Montmartre. Services depart every 15 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 26 min.
Yes, there is a direct train departing from Anatole France and arriving at Sentier. Services depart every 10 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 17 min.
The distance between Levallois-Perret and Bonne Nouvelle is 6 km.
The best way to get from Levallois-Perret to Bonne Nouvelle without a car is to line 3 subway and line 9 subway which takes 19 min and costs €3.
It takes approximately 19 min to get from Levallois-Perret to Bonne Nouvelle, including transfers.
